When I split the crankcases I noticed there was no pre-formed gasket between them only some remains of a paste of sorts. Now I'm looking to stick it all back together I consult the great book of lies to find that it was most probably remains of Suzuki Bond 1207B.
As I'm sure we all have gallons of the stuff sat around doing nothing in our garages would ordinary instant gasket such as this be a suitable replacement and if not what is recommended? Now I know the obvious answer to this is get some Suzuki Bond 1207B from one of the many people that have said gallons doing nothing, but if I want to make a start this weekend and expect to have to order it in, you can see my quandary... |

Don't go mad with the stuff, remember it is squishing down to practically no thickness and you don't want loads to block your oil strainer and blow the engine.
Also clean and degrease everything.
